Relationship of adolescents' lifestyles and their oral health

Objective: To analyse the relationship between the lifestyle of adolescents and their oral health. Method: Descriptive documentary study, working with a population of 15 scientific articles published in PubMed. Conclusion: The relationship between the lifestyle of adolescents and their oral health is undeniable and multifaceted. The prevalence of inadequate dietary habits, poor oral hygiene and the consumption of harmful substances contribute significantly to the occurrence of oral diseases in this population. However, regular physical activity and increased general health awareness may mitigate some of these adverse effects.
